Evaluating Transport Modes for Your Cargo

Selecting the right transport mode is the most critical decision for your bottom line. For large-scale industrial goods, sea freight remains the most cost-effective solution despite longer lead times. Alternatively, time-sensitive shipments benefit significantly from air freight services, which offer unmatched speed.

Many importers also utilize express service options to handle urgent inventory replenishment. By analyzing your specific volume and delivery schedule, you can optimize your logistics budget and improve overall efficiency.

Method Cost Transit Time Best For
Sea Freight Low 25-35 Days Bulk Goods
Air Freight High 3-7 Days Urgent Items
Express Premium 2-5 Days Samples

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average transit time for sea freight?

Sea freight from major Chinese ports to Mexican ports typically takes between 25 and 35 days, depending on the specific route and port congestion.

How can I reduce my import costs?

To reduce costs, consolidate smaller shipments into full container loads, optimize your packaging to save space, and work with a freight forwarder to secure better volume rates.

What documents are required for customs?

Essential documents include the comm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any specific import permits or certificates of origin required by Mexican authorities.

Is air freight worth the extra cost?

Air freight is worth the cost if you have high-value, time-sensitive goods where the cost of a stockout exceeds the premium shipping fees of air transport.

How do I track my shipment?

Most professional logistics providers offer online tracking portals where you can use your bill of lading or container number to view real-time location updates.

What is the difference between FCL and LCL?

FCL stands for Full Container Load, where you rent an entire container. LCL is Less than Container Load, where you share container space with other shippers to save money.
